## Что такое CAN-шина в автомобилях
CAN (Controller Area Network) — это протокол связи, используемый в автомобилях для обмена данными между электронными блоками управления (ЭБУ). Он разработан для обеспечения надежной и высокоскоростной передачи данных в условиях повышенной электромагнитной интерференции, характерной для автомобильной среды.
### Структура CAN-шины
CAN-шина состоит из двух витых пар проводов, которые используются для передачи и приема данных. Каждая пара состоит из провода CAN High и CAN Low. Данные передаются с помощью дифференциальной сигнализации, которая подавляет электромагнитные помехи.
На каждом конце CAN-шины расположены терминаторы, которые отражают сигналы назад на шину, предотвращая их исчезновение. Это гарантирует целостность сигнала и стабильность сети.
### Принцип работы CAN-шины
CAN-шина использует принцип множественного доступа с разделением по времени (TDMA), при котором каждый узел шины имеет возможность передавать данные в определенный момент времени. Это предотвращает коллизии данных и гарантирует, что все узлы могут обмениваться информацией без помех.
Каждый узел шины имеет уникальный идентификатор (ID), который используется для приоритезации передаваемых сообщений. Сообщения с более высоким приоритетом передаются первыми.
### Преимущества CAN-шины
Надежность: Дифференциальная сигнализация и терминаторы делают CAN-шину чрезвычайно устойчивой к шуму и помехам.
Высокая скорость: CAN-шина может передавать данные со скоростью до 1 Мбит/с, обеспечивая быстрый обмен информацией.
Гибкость: CAN-шина может легко расширяться за счет добавления новых узлов без изменения конфигурации сети.
Низкая стоимость: CAN-шина является относительно недорогой в установке и обслуживании.
### CAN-шина в автомобилях
В современных автомобилях CAN-шина используется для связи между различными электронными системами, включая:
Двигатель (ECU): Управление двигателем, контроль выбросов, диагностика.
Трансмиссия (ECU): Автоматическая коробка передач, дифференциал.
Тормоза (ABS/EBD): Антиблокировочная система тормозов, распределение тормозного усилия.
Рулевое управление (EPS): Электроусилитель руля, контроль устойчивости.
Кузовной блок (BCM): Управление освещением, стеклоподъемниками, замками.
Приборная панель (IPC): Отображение информации для водителя.
CAN-шина позволяет этим системам обмениваться данными и координировать свою работу для обеспечения более плавного вождения, улучшенной безопасности и меньшего расхода топлива.
### Диагностика CAN-шины
Диагностика неисправностей CAN-шины может быть сложной задачей. Для этого обычно используются специализированные диагностические инструменты, такие как считыватели кодов неисправностей (OBD-II) и сканеры CAN-шины.
Обычные симптомы неисправностей CAN-шины включают:
Проблемы с запуском двигателя
Неработающие или некорректно работающие электронные системы
Отображение кодов неисправностей, связанных с CAN-шиной
### Дальнейшее развитие CAN-шины
CAN-шина постоянно развивается, чтобы соответствовать растущим требованиям автомобильной промышленности. Недавние улучшения включают:
CAN FD (Flexible Data-rate): Позволяет передавать данные со скоростью до 10 Мбит/с для более быстрого обмена данными.
CAN XL (Extended Length): Расширяет максимальную длину сообщения до 2048 бит для передачи более сложных данных.
Беспроводная CAN-шина: Обеспечивает беспроводную связь между узлами CAN-шины для повышения гибкости и снижения затрат на проводку.
Эти усовершенствования позволяют CAN-шине оставаться важным компонентом в автомобильных сетях, обеспечивая надежную и эффективную передачу данных между все более сложными электронными системами.